D/M 37983

Chief Petty Officer Cook

Powton, Richard Foard

 

 

 

 

Royal Navy

HMS Exeter.

United Kingdom

 

Died

Died:-

1939/12/17 - Died after being wounded in  battle with German Admiral Graf Spee 150 miles off the River Plate estuary.

Age:-

33

 

Loved Ones

Son of Thomas and Louise Powton: husband of Stella Powton, of Okehampton, Devon.

 

Memorial

Sec. L. Grave 1149.

STANLEY CEMETERY, FALKLAND ISLANDS

Falkland Islands
